HOA Fees and Financial Obligations

The Homeowners Association at The Country Club of Mount Dora is responsible for overseeing the maintenance and enhancement of common areas, ensuring compliance with community standards, and providing services that benefit all residents. To fund these initiatives, the HOA collects mandatory fees from homeowners. While specific fee amounts can vary depending on the size of the property or lot, the annual HOA dues typically range between $800 and $1,200, payable either annually or in quarterly installments. These fees cover a variety of services, including landscaping of common areas, maintenance of community facilities, security measures, and administrative costs. Additionally, there may be special assessments for one-time projects, such as major repairs or upgrades to shared amenities, though these are communicated to residents well in advance. Prospective buyers are encouraged to review the HOA's financial statements and budget during the home-buying process to understand the full scope of financial obligations. The HOA strives to maintain transparency in its financial dealings, ensuring that funds are allocated efficiently to preserve the community's high standards.

Rules and Regulations

The HOA at The Country Club of Mount Dora enforces a set of rules and regulations designed to protect property values and foster a harmonious living environment. These guidelines cover a wide range of topics, including architectural standards, landscaping requirements, and community behavior. For instance, homeowners are required to submit plans for exterior modifications—such as painting, fencing, or major landscaping changes—to the HOA's Architectural Review Committee for approval. This ensures that all changes align with the community's aesthetic standards, which emphasize a cohesive and well-maintained appearance. Additionally, there are rules regarding pet ownership, noise levels, and the use of common areas to promote respect among neighbors. Parking regulations may restrict overnight street parking or the storage of recreational vehicles on properties, maintaining a neat and uncluttered look throughout the neighborhood. The HOA provides a detailed handbook to residents upon moving in, and violations of these rules may result in warnings or fines, depending on the severity of the infraction. While some residents may find the rules stringent, they are ultimately in place to preserve the community's appeal and ensure a consistent quality of life for all.

Community Amenities

One of the standout features of The Country Club of Mount Dora is its impressive array of amenities, many of which are managed and maintained by the HOA. At the heart of the community lies the championship 18-hole golf course, a major draw for residents who enjoy the sport. Designed to challenge players of all skill levels, the course offers stunning views of the surrounding landscape and is complemented by a pro shop and practice facilities. Beyond golf, the community boasts a clubhouse that serves as a social hub, hosting events, gatherings, and dining options for residents. Other amenities include tennis courts, a swimming pool, and walking trails that wind through the beautifully landscaped grounds. These facilities provide ample opportunities for recreation and relaxation, catering to a variety of interests and lifestyles. The HOA ensures that these amenities are well-maintained, scheduling regular upkeep and addressing any issues promptly to keep them in top condition for resident use.

Lifestyle at The Country Club of Mount Dora

Living in The Country Club of Mount Dora offers a lifestyle that balances tranquility with activity. The community is known for its friendly, close-knit atmosphere, where neighbors often form lasting connections through social events and shared interests. The HOA plays a key role in fostering this sense of community by organizing activities such as holiday celebrations, golf tournaments, and fitness classes. The location in Mount Dora, often referred to as the "Festival City," adds to the appeal, with residents enjoying easy access to the city's vibrant downtown area, which features boutique shops, restaurants, and year-round events. The proximity to natural attractions like Lake Dora and the Harris Chain of Lakes also provides opportunities for boating, fishing, and outdoor exploration. Whether you're an active retiree seeking a peaceful yet engaging environment or a family looking for a safe and welcoming neighborhood, The Country Club of Mount Dora delivers a lifestyle that caters to diverse needs.
